Jessica Brown Findlay: The star of Downton Abbey recounts her obstacle course to become a mother

The star of the program Downton Abbey, Jessica Brown Findlayconfided that she was trying to have a baby, despite difficulties, with her husband Ziggy Heath. The actress is currently undergoing heavy treatment for fertility.

For International Women’s Day, the actress revealed that her couple had difficulty having a child and have already completed four treatments to promote fertility. The 32-year-old then shared a video where we see her getting a hormone injection. She then added in the comment:Happy International Women’s Day! Here we do things that are not easy but then we go dancing.“The interpreter of the iconic Lady Sybil Crawley continued:”IVF made me realize what women are capable of doing and accomplishing when we go through times of pain and deep sadness. Your body is not an enemy. Love it. It doesn’t matter what happens there. I send love and support to all the women I’ve met and even those I don’t know but to tell you that I know what it’s like.

The actress concluded her benevolent message with a note of humor in reference to her dress on the video, “I recommend doing all of this while wearing vintage clothes. love, love, love“, before many fans gave their support to the Englishwoman. They also thanked her for speaking out and the positive vibes she was giving off.”Thank you for your secrets about your vulnerability. You are a real warrior! I send you my prayers !” could we read.
